Applying to become a police officer is in stages. After you fill up the police application form, you will be called for an assessment in a center where you will go through physical and mental tests. This assessment is estimated to last four to five hours and is standardized in 43 forces in England and Wales so that so you will go through the same tests regardless of what force you are applying to. If you pass the assessment, you will then be asked to give your medical history as guided by a questionnaire.

After everything, you will be sent a "candidate feedback" where the results of your tests will be detailed. You will be a police officer if you passed everything. The tests can be gruelling but tips are posted online.

However, the job has a competitive salary and benefits that can give you security amidst the crisis that the world is experiencing today. Although there is no standard wage for police officers because the rate varies from force to force, the average is 20,000-22,000.

The starting pay is 22,104 upon joining the force and rises to 24,675 after 31 weeks when the initial training is completed. In the Metropolitan Police Service, London Weighting is 2,055 and London Allowances will earn you 4,338 making your pay 28,497 during training and 31,068 later. Police officers in the bigger cities are generally paid more than those in the rural areas.

There are a lot more good things that go with your decision to become a police officer because your benefits are as generous as your wage. If you make it to the force; you will receive an excellent pension, various promotion opportunities, the option to specialize in a particular field such as firearms and you will have flexible working hours. Any overtime that you make will be paid and you will be given generous holiday allowance of 23 days plus ban holidays. You will also be eligible for the key workers scheme and on top of that you will have paid sick leave.

If you decide to be a police officer you will have to fill an application and if you are successful with it, you will undergo different tests. There will be no need for a formal education and no minimum or maximum height will be required. You do have to be a British Citizen or a citizen of EU or other states in EEA. If you are a foreign national or a Commonwealth Citizen, your application will be accepted as long as you have an indefinite leave to remain in UK. Physical and Mental capability is a must in order for your application to be acknowledged.
